353 Shares 7605 views

Lista de los lenguajes de programación. Los lenguajes de programación de bajo y de alto nivel

A medida que el desarrollo de la tecnología informática no se queda quieto y mejorar constantemente los métodos y técnicas de programación y lenguajes de programación. Considere qué idiomas hay en el campo de la informática moderna y su clasificación.

visión de conjunto

Lista de los lenguajes de programación son tan amplia y variada que está totalmente extendido – una tarea casi imposible. Entre todos los idiomas se pueden dividir en tres grupos principales:

  • (Lenguajes de programación de bajo nivel) de la máquina;
  • orientado a máquina (montadores);
  • independiente de la máquina (nivel alto);

Entre los desarrolladores de software moderno son los siguientes lenguajes de programación básicos más populares. Lista en orden de popularidad descendente:

  1. SQL.
  2. Java.
  3. XML.
  4. C ++.
  5. HTML.
  6. Visual Basic.
  7. XSL.
  8. Delphi.

Esta lista de lenguajes de programación está lejos de ser completa, pero son los idiomas más populares, el conocimiento de que pueden requerir un programador para un trabajo. Todos ellos son los lenguajes de programación de alto nivel.

Fundamentos de programación

la programación de bajo nivel – estos son los idiomas que necesite tener en cuenta el tipo y capacidades del procesador. Los operadores y los métodos de funcionamiento de este tipo de lenguajes de programación son lo suficientemente cerca del código de máquina, que requieren el conocimiento de la memoria del PC y el procesador vuelve hacia ella.

Es difícil llamar a varios lenguajes de programación de bajo nivel. Lista todavía se reducirá a una primacía del lenguaje – el ensamblador. Ya que permite que los códigos de programas en la notación cerca de código de máquina, el ensamblador utiliza exclusivamente para la escritura de software del sistema, tales como sistemas operativos, controladores de dispositivos y en la programación de códigos de chip de control.

La desventaja de este tipo de lenguajes de programación es que están escritos en el programa para realizar tareas específicas en un dispositivo en particular, y su ejecución no es posible en el caso de traslado a otro procesador.

Desarrollo de aplicaciones

Lista de los lenguajes de programación para crear aplicaciones personalizadas, así como para el desarrollo y la implementación de programas de usuario tiene miles de artículos. ¿Cómo entender una variedad tan debido al hecho de que una lengua particular es adecuado para resolver diversas tareas.

A pesar de que estos lenguajes de programación se determina en un grupo separado, su aplicación se lleva a cabo en el código máquina. Para ejecutar el programa línea a línea y lista para traducirlo a código de máquina mediante un software especial – intérpretes. Si la traducción del código de un idioma a otro se lleva a cabo sin realizar equipos, a continuación, que participan en este programa los compiladores. En general, los programas diseñados para traducir los programas escritos en un lenguaje de programación formal sobre otra, llamados traductores.

Considere más lenguajes de programación de alto nivel. La lista será no sólo escribir algunos detalles sobre cada uno de los más populares.

SQL

lenguaje de programación especializado diseñado principalmente para su uso con sistemas de gestión de bases de datos y programación. SQL se traduce como "una especializada lenguaje de consulta." Desde las últimas décadas del mercado de DBMS ha crecido muchas veces, la popularidad de la lengua no se convierte en una sorpresa.

Hay diferentes puntos de vista sobre el futuro de la lengua. Definitivamente se cree que la tecnología para la creación de relaciones de base de datos estaba en la altura, pero su tiempo se está acabando. La necesidad de un desarrollo en relación con los crecientes volúmenes de datos procesados conduce expertos a creer que la humanidad no es más que necesaria transición de la tecnología relacional de post-relacional en el futuro, pero con el fin de preservar la compatibilidad con los bancos de datos existentes.

javascript

A la derecha es el segundo mayor lenguajes de programación de alto nivel. Fácil de aprender, fácil de usar. El aumento en comparación con el progenitor de la programación de la aptitud conduce al hecho de que el trabajo con este lenguaje de millones de personas en todo el mundo. lenguaje orientado a objetos basado en C ++, adaptado a la creación de programas y aplicaciones que pueden manejar grandes cantidades de información en entornos especializados y adaptados a las condiciones de ejecución específica del acabado del producto.

Tecnología Java – es la base que permite a cantidades ilimitadas para aumentar las empresas de infraestructura y empresas que pueden enlazar juntos el sistema más diverso calibre se conecte a la red a través de teléfonos Wi-Fi a superordenadores.

XML

Un descendiente de HTML, esta tecnología es un lenguaje de marcado extensible. Está adaptado para interpretar los documentos. En él para llevar a cabo complejos documentos transformación y cambio. XML se utiliza para transmitir y almacenar datos temporalmente cuando se trabaja con diferentes bases de datos relacionales a través de Internet.

XML ya ha llegado a un nivel en el que puede presumir de ser el fundamental para la tecnología de red de la empresa.

Programamos en ruso

La mayoría de los lenguajes de programación utilizan el vocabulario de la lengua Inglés. Sin embargo, aparte de estos, también hay lenguajes de programación rusos. Lista de la pequeña de Rusia y el área temática en la que se utilizan, es muy especializado. Estos son algunos ejemplos.

  • 1C: Enterprise. Todo el sistema está diseñado para la gestión de la organización en todos los ámbitos de actividad. A menudo, los anuncios en la búsqueda de empleados pueden cumplir "1C programador".
  • El verbo. analógico en idioma Inglés de Pascal.
  • Robic. lenguaje de programación especializado diseñado para enseñar a los niños los fundamentos de la programación.
  • Rapier. Tipos dinámicos idioma, basado en los procedimientos.

Como se puede ver, la lista de los idiomas es tan amplia y variada que es imposible cubrir cualquier clasificación y listas. Si usted decide hacer la programación a nivel amateur o profesional, a continuación, recordar que el programador – una profesión creativa que requiere no sólo conocimientos, sino también la fantasía, la imaginación, la intuición, e incluso un poco de suerte.